Project Summary:

What text should be included in the main part of the logo?
SmileiQ.com (with .com)

What type of product or service do you offer?
A consumer information and membership site all about your smile

How long have you been in business?
Consulting for 8 years (as a dentist and dental consultant)

What do you hope to accomplish with your new identity?
Establish myself as the Internet Dental Expert and the website as the source for dental answers

What are your long term goals?
I plan to build this website into a major informational site for people looking for answers to their dental problems.

When is the deadline for final entries before choosing a designer?
May 9

Audience Profile:
Please describe your existing audience
Female ages 18-50 with money and vanity concerns. Women who are looking for solutions to their dental and cosmetic dental problems.

Who would you like to add to your audience?
Yes. Men who care about their teeth but don't want to seek help from a dentist or without time or $ to spend on dental care

Perception/Tone/Guidelines:

What type of logo would you like?
Flashy, radiating,clever, "smart"

Do you have any colors in mind for your logo? (if so, why?)
A shade of red, white, black, and another color. Appeal to female but look professional.

Do you have any specific images or icons in mind that you would definitely like to see incorporated into your logo?
SmileiQ.com - perhaps a smiley face somewhere without making it look kiddie. We can include a separate symbol in it.

Communication Strategy:

What attributes would you like your logo to reflect about your business?
Classy and fun. italicize,bold. surprise me.

What is your tagline or slogan?
Internet's #1 Source for your Smile

What is the overall message you are trying to convey to your target audience?
Come here for all your answers to your smile. We are experts.... we have the solution to your dental concerns.

Where will your new logo be used?
All marketing materials including web, letterhead, bc, brochures, emails, ezines,

Competitive Positioning:

Who are your competitors and what do you think about their logos?
none really. Currently the only competitors are local dentists who want people to find their website. Most of the time the info on their sites is minimal and does not address a lot of answers.

List competitive URLs if possible

What sets you apart from your competitors?
real good info, real answers from an expert. interactive site with great material, including tips, tricks and reviews.

Targeted Message:
State a single-minded word or phrase that will appropriately describe your company: Thorough and Savvy. :)

When logo is complete, site design will be next.
